Bakuchi is also known as “ Shvitraghni” because of its properties to treat Vitiligo, that is a skin concern where some parts of the skin lose its pigmentation. The active ingredient in Bakuchi is “Psoralens” which on exposure to sun forms melanin in depigmented skin. Ayurvedic therapy involves local application of the herbal paste or Lepa of the herbal decoction. Recently, the oil has been used to reduce skin inflammation and flaking seen in psoriasis. The active coumarins present in the oil inhibit the synthesis of new DNA in skin cells, which reduces the rate of cell proliferation, (continuous production of new skin cell). These help to promote skin healing in chronic conditions like psoriasis [6]. A 2012 study showed that extracts obtained from Psoralea corylifolia seeds showed almost 76% activity in the treatment of psoriasis, when compared to the control group.[7] A later 2019 review discusses how bakuchiol can help stop cancer cell growth. Previous research shows it has an effect on stomach, breast, and skin cancer cells. However, early research is done in animals and in vitro (not in animals or people), so it’s unclear yet how this will translate to humans. The plant extracts have been reported to possess antibacterial, antioxidant, antifungal and immunomodulatory activity. They have been used as dietary supplements to naturally control blood sugar in cases of diabetes and the calcium rich seeds have been known to improve bone health (3). Skin and Hair Care BenefitsBabchi oil can protect the skin against bacterial and fungal infections. It is particularly effective against organisms that are commonly found on the dermis of the skin, like Staphylococcus aureus,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Escherichia coli. It is also used to reduce redness or itching caused by various skin conditions such as dermatitis and eczema. [5] If babchi seeds are cold-pressed or expeller-pressed, you have Psoralea corylifolia seed oil. If the seeds or leaves are macerated in oil or extracted with a solvent (i.e. ethanol, acetone), you have Psoralea corylifolia seed/leaf extract. Again, these might be referred to as babchi oil or bakuchi oil - but they represent an unrefined carrier oil and not the pure chemical form of Bakuchiol that is sought after. Cullen corylifolium extract contains numerous phytochemicals, including flavonoids ( neobavaisoflavone, isobavachalcone, bavachalcone, bavachinin, bavachin, corylin, corylifol, corylifolin and 6-prenylnaringenin), coumarins ( psoralidin, psoralen, isopsoralen and angelicin), meroterpenes ( bakuchiol, and 3-hydroxybakuchiol). Bakuchiol, one of the components of the oil, is often compared to retinol although more research is still needed to fully support this claim. Retinol is an A vitamin and acts on the elastin and collagen in the skin, giving a plumping effect that smoothes fine lines and wrinkles. Bakuchiol is thought to have the same properties while being much gentler on the skin. What are the benefits of the cold-pressing method?
